# Artifact Signing — GraphScope

All GraphScope (dependency graph visualizer) release artifacts are signed in CI. New team members: never build release tarballs locally. Verify downloads before promotion; unsigned artifacts are rejected by the Fernhollow registry. Verification uses the team's current public signing key, reproduced below for convenience.

signing key of bagap-yawep = bky13_TbfT6ZMUoGJo2

**Ticket: Phase 2 of legacy ORM refactor — relation mapping**

For those new to the Quillstack codebase: the legacy ORM layer in `corelib/persist` still uses implicit lazy-loading, which causes N+1 queries in the invoice module. This ticket covers migrating relation mappings to explicit fetch plans, one model at a time, with parity tests on each. Please review the migration guide first. Reference the baseline build recorded below.

pipeline stamp: htk31_f769b577b3028a4e9958e5bb8d1259a

## Further reading

For those joining the weekly eng sync on the Pickwright optimizer, the short version: it batches orders into pick routes using a modified savings heuristic, with congestion penalties per aisle. The heuristic's tradeoffs — why we dropped exact solving, how the aisle-penalty weights were tuned, and the known failure mode with cold-storage zones — are documented in depth in the design dossier. That dossier, including benchmark data, lives on the page below.

runbook for badug-kadup: https://confluence.zemvarlabs.internal/projects/browse/display/projects/bd1b